You will find clevis pins in both metric and imperial sizes made from stainless steel and steel and zinc plated finishing, which protects them from corrosion. Ansi clevis pin size chart table. When ordering clevises, there are several pieces of information that need to be specified including clevis number, finish, diameter of tap, thread direction, grip, and pin. Pin length tabulated is intended for use with standard clevis, without spacers. Clevis pins use different cotter pin sizes. Industrial hardware & specialties’ clevises are manufactured to meet the dimensional and load ratings in accordance with the american institute of steel construction. Designed to be used with a cotter pin to connect two forked ends of one object to another structural member, such as attaching a pipe hanger to a support beam.
